## ORM Refactor Notes

We're replacing the legacy Quillbase ORM layer with repository classes, one module at a time. Review checklist: no raw query strings outside `repos/`, all migrations reversible, and the old `ActiveRow` mixin must not appear in new code. Integration tests hit the Marrowtide staging database directly. Test runs authenticate to the staging data service using the key that follows.

gateway credential: kto3_qfe

## QueueScale Onboarding

Welcome aboard. QueueScale watches broker queue depth and resizes the Fennelworks worker pool. Clone the repo, copy `env.sample` to `.env`, and set `QS_POLL_INTERVAL=15`.

Scaling decisions are pushed to the control plane, which authenticates requests with a shared secret. Before first run, append this line to your `.env`:

env line for fafof-fahag: LEDGER_TOKEN5=f8790

# Glyphden Environments

Glyphden vendors all third-party fonts; nothing is fetched at runtime. Staging pulls the vendored bundle from the Hollowpine artifact store; production uses a pinned snapshot cut at release time. Licenses are checked at build, not deploy. Release managers: never promote a build whose font manifest hash differs between environments — that is drift, and it blocks sign-off. Each environment resolves the bundle via the settings below. Production currently runs with these values.

config for kafof-bawef:
holath:
  log_level: debug
  metrics_host: metrics.holath.qorvelsys.internal
  pin: 2191
  pool_size: 32

// Plugin authors: this constant caps the payload size Crashlet will
// accept from third-party report decorators. Oversized payloads are
// dropped silently by the Fenwick ingest tier, so stay under the limit.
// Behavior changed in the latest pipeline release; verify your plugin
// against it. The build token for that release is given below.

pipeline stamp: htk9_6ce9d33c5

## Build Provenance — Ledgerscope Audit-Log Viewer

Welcome aboard. Every Ledgerscope release is built on our hermetic runners, and each artifact carries a signed provenance record tying it to the exact source revision and toolchain. Before shipping a hotfix, verify the provenance attestation matches the release manifest — never hand-build artifacts locally. Each verified build is identified by the token shown below.

session token of kageg-tahop = htk14_af3c1ccccb7dcf